A Guide to Choosing the Right Ingredients for Your Handcrafted Lip Balm
When producing a custom lip balm, selecting the suitable substances is essential for achieving the optimal texture and effectiveness. Base oils including coconut, sweet almond, or jojoba deliver hydration and ease of application. Beeswax or botanical waxes serve as thickening agents, creating a protective barrier while making certain the balm retains its form.
Additionally, applying butters like shea or cocoa promotes hydration and softness. To incorporate nourishment, essential oils and natural extracts might be combined, offering potential benefits like soothing or revitalizing properties.
It is also important to factor in the balance of ingredients; too much wax can lead to a hard balm, while overabundant oil may cause a runny texture. Ultimately, careful selection of components not only impacts the lip balm’s texture but also its complete attractiveness and effectiveness, making it vital for anyone looking to create a distinctive product.

For what duration does homemade lip balm remain good?
Homemade lip balm typically lasts six months to one year when stored in a cooler, dim area. Proper sanitation during preparation and using natural preservatives can extend shelf life, ensuring quality and safety for use.
